带你揭开运维自动化的面纱:Ansible业务自动化之路(1)
2016-02-20 19:33:59 来源: 李松涛 马哥Linux运维 评论:0 点击:
再来看看代码量。
第四章:练就18式,拿下自动化
基础模块13式
作为基础模块,熟悉掌握即能完全驾驭ansible日常工作90%自动化工作,简单指数5星。
辅助模块5式
拥备基础模块,同时配合辅助模块可使已有成果更上一层楼,简单指数 4星。
第四章:AnsibleUi -jumpserver
话说自动化怎么能停留在工具时代,但 tower 又收费,如何破?
jumpserver 完全开源的,堡垒机功能日趋完善,自动化发布平台底层也基于 Ansible 实现,更多精彩可参考http://jumpserver.org/ 。
最新功能:
第五章:后记分享目录
分享目录及方式参考
参考http://www.178linux.com/doc/ansible/翻译的内容按功能模块结合业务实践以场景化方式逐一讲解。
问题反馈路径 http://www.178linux.com/qa/重复收看 http://www.osstep.com。
群友Q/A
问题1:发布为啥是用ansible去打包的?
最小化最简化原则,运维需要懂的工具很多,需要熟练不会太多,精一通百的人毕竟少数,精力也是有限,就如用阿里云,ucloud就推荐使用他们的“四大件”。
问题2:ansible在上千机器的集群中有没有瓶颈?
这个我如实回答,我知道的还没有。数百台的应用是有的。但我觉得RedHat都不担心这个问题,我们更不需要担心,看看kvm,docker的发展就是指导。
问题3:ansible在win上只支持nt不支持2003 如何解决?
A:只能说是所有开源软件的通病,windows闭源已经深知其中的痛点,近些年不是一直有传言会开源吗?哈哈!
问题4:ansible在上千机器的集群中有没有瓶颈?
有瓶颈,一次在千台以上建议salt,万台建议go自己写,主要是消息回收master受不了。
问题5:我想知道部署的时候,有没有向移动端发展的趋势!
A:有,前沿的大公司已经在用,如鹅厂,jumpserver.org也在首面放在 mobile的daemon。
问题6:感觉ansibie异常的时候不好排错!有没有好的方法?
A:这样问是因为你还不熟悉,多被磨磨就好。python的报错输出和shell一样简单。见过JAVA的复杂日志输出会深有体会,看完我们开发同学输出的日志再看ansible的报错输出是觉得好幸福。哈哈!
问题7:我们可否跟监控服务器联动,一旦执行出错马上报警,并且让系统提供出错日志。
A:ansible本身提供mail alert功能,你可以把ansible日志记录到syslog里面,用ELK 或者splunk来实现报警。
Ansible原著翻译团队
联系人:stanley (微信号: fengzhilinux) 5. Ansible专题分享,请把你想听到的想学到的录入到 http://www.178linux.com/qa/。
Ansible部落
致力全球流行技术本土化
运维部落---Ansible部落群功能:1. Ansible的翻译工作马上就要结束进行最后的 review 阶段,你知道吗?2. 为方便各位第一时间接受最新技术前沿,我们成立运维部落微信订阅号,除了每日分享,定期更新外,还有大虾不定期解惑,欢迎关注!
【编辑推荐】
上一篇:火热的DevOps,你了解多少
下一篇:物超所值的七大Windows安全工具